size: 16 inchs, pendant 1 x 1 inches weight: 2.36 grams material: 14k white gold gemstones: natural diamonds: 1.00ctw, I clarity, G-H color Notes from the Curator This 14-karat white gold open-heart diamond pendant crosses a full carat at I clarity and near-colorless G-H, a grading that places the stones just beneath the D–F colorless echelon yet well above any perceptible warmth. The open-heart silhouette—continuous outline unbroken by a center fill—emerged in mid-twentieth-century sentimental jewelry as a gesture of vulnerability and receptiveness, a heart that holds space for love rather than sealing it in. The design relies on melee pavé, small brilliant-cut diamonds set with minimal metal, which multiplies fire without competing for visual real estate against the symbol itself. At one carat total weight distributed around the outline, this necklace achieves presence while remaining wearable on a 16-inch chain; the stones' I clarity means inclusions are confined to the interior, leaving the surface brilliant to the unaided eye, and the combined weight crosses the psychological threshold at which a piece reads as serious rather than token.
